Transaction 21d668f3b0da03ddfb4a990f9426ff3752f925328e17f83b512096f924f31d7b
1 Input
1 Output
-
21d668f3b0da03ddfb4a990f9426ff3752f925328e17f83b512096f924f31d7b:0
- value
- 3455
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c84acf066d2edc2ffbf48f4d7c4d2b05b0848da947017557e20904b290d3f5a2
- address
- bc1pep9v7pnd9mwzl7l53axhcnftqkcgfrdfguqh24lzpyzt9yxn7k3q373hyd